The Rise of Voice Search and Mobile-First Experiences
Voice assistants, such as Siri, Google Assistant, and Alexa, are now commonplace in homes and on mobile devices. By 2025, an increasing number of people will use voice search to request local information. Phrases like "best bakery near me" or "local plumber open now" will become even more frequent. For businesses to benefit, they must optimize their content and listings for these voice-based searches. This means ensuring your local digital marketing strategy includes fast-loading websites, mobile-friendly design, and concise business descriptions. Structured data and schema markup will also play a bigger role in helping search engines understand your location and services. Businesses that prepare for mobile-first and voice-first customers will gain a significant competitive advantage over those that lag.
Hyper-Local Content Will Build Trust and Engagement
One trend that will dominate the future is the use of hyper-local content. This involves creating blog posts, videos, and social media updates that focus on your neighborhood, city, or region. This kind of content speaks directly to local customers and builds trust over time. For example, a business might write about local events, customer stories, or community news while also linking the content back to their services. When combined with local SEO services, this type of content helps you rank higher in local searches and encourages customers to return. If you're in local seo for eCommerce, content can include guides like "Top Gift Ideas from [City Name] Stores" or "Locally Made Products You Can Buy Online."
E-commerce Businesses Will Lean Heavily on Local SEO
In the past, eCommerce mainly focused on national or global audiences. However, many online businesses are now realizing the power of local customers. Thanks to faster shipping options and local pickup features, even digital stores are competing for nearby buyers. This has made local SEO for eCommerce a growing strategy for online shops that want to connect with buyers in their area. Online stores that use local SEO optimization can target city-based keywords, get listed in local directories, and create location-based product landing pages. These changes help increase visibility in nearby searches and attract more traffic from people who prefer shopping locally, even online.
Customer Reviews and Social Proof Will Matter More
In the future, customer reviews will carry even more weight in local rankings. Search engines use reviews to measure trust, while customers use them to decide whether to contact a business. Encouraging reviews, responding to feedback, and showcasing positive comments on your site will be essential parts of your local digital marketing plan. Social proof also encompasses elements such as customer testimonials, user-generated content, and endorsements from local influencers. These help build your reputation and increase conversions. Businesses that actively manage and promote their reviews will have an easier time standing out in crowded markets.
